You can select Pulse to have the master's LED flash at the intervals of the waveform. The interval
between when the channel ON command is sent to the target device and when the channel OFF
command is sent can be set in the Pulse interval time field. The field will accept any value between
1 and 100. The time is measured in tenths of a second.

Restore Default Window Settings

This restore feature returns all of IREdit's dockable windows to the default arrangement. Go to
View > Restore Default Window Settings to reset the dockable windows.

IR Update Wizard Dialog

The IR Update Wizard takes you through the steps necessary to downloading available updates for
the AMX IR database. An internet connection is necessary for the update to work.
